Kens Pizza.. also one of the last affordable lunch stops in Lake Havasu..

You can get in and out of this place for 12-13 bucks. Big slice and a drink.. I think if ya add a dollar you get a beer.

Anyhow they have a decent hot Italian and I’m in and out for 11-12 bucks? All the delis are over 20.00 now when you get a drink. Borns for example is 23 then they tag ya for the tip putting ya at 25.00.


Anyhow back to Ken’s Pizza here’s the pics.. highly recommends for pizza and an affordable lunch stop.

Humberto’s.. better tan Filibertos next door for lunch if you are going to decide between the two.

This particular day I did a pollo Assada burrito / wet. Guacamole and pico inside with the pollo..

Honestly it was decent. Not California taco shop quality but better tan most in this town that has “blah” Mexican food. I’d recommend.

I usually get a carne asada burrito and add sour cream to the guacamole and pico.. extra hot sauce and it’s not to shabby at all!

I do hate the fact that they try and tag you for a tip in the drive thru.. then If you don’t give them one they Try to hold the hot sauce ransom or give you attitude..

Anyhow Humberto’s is probably my pick for burrito shop in Havasu. I will note it is not open 24/7..
